The Ultimate Guide To Renting A Conversion Van

If you’re planning a road trip or a vacation with a group of friends or family, renting a conversion van might be the perfect solution for your transportation needs. A conversion van, also known as a camper van or Class B motorhome, offers a unique and versatile travel experience that combines the convenience of a traditional vehicle with the comfort and amenities of a small RV. Before you hit the road in a conversion van, here are some things you should know about renting one.

**Why Rent a Conversion Van?**

There are several reasons why renting a conversion van can be a great choice for your travel plans. Firstly, conversion vans provide ample space for passengers and cargo, making them ideal for long road trips or camping adventures. They also come equipped with basic amenities such as a bed, storage space, and sometimes a small kitchenette, allowing you to save money on accommodation and dining out.

Furthermore, conversion vans are more maneuverable and easier to drive than larger RVs, making them a practical choice for travelers who are not experienced with driving large vehicles. Additionally, conversion vans typically have better fuel efficiency compared to larger motorhomes, saving you money on gas during your journey.

**How to Rent a Conversion Van**

Renting a conversion van is a straightforward process that is similar to renting a car. First, you’ll need to research rental companies in your area that offer conversion vans for rent. Make sure to compare prices, availability, and customer reviews to find a reputable rental company that meets your needs.

Once you’ve selected a rental company, you’ll need to reserve your conversion van in advance to ensure availability for your desired travel dates. Most rental companies require a valid driver’s license, a credit card for payment, and a minimum age requirement for renters. Some companies may also require a security deposit or proof of insurance.

Before you pick up your conversion van, make sure to inspect the vehicle for any existing damage and take note of its current mileage. Familiarize yourself with the van’s features and amenities, including how to operate any appliances or systems. It’s also a good idea to ask the rental company for a demonstration of how to set up and break down any sleeping or dining areas inside the van.

**Tips for Renting a Conversion Van**

To make the most of your conversion van rental experience, consider the following tips:

1. Plan your route and itinerary in advance to maximize your time on the road and ensure you visit all the destinations you want to see.

2. Pack lightly and efficiently to avoid clutter and make the most of the van’s storage space. Consider bringing collapsible or multi-purpose items to save space.

3. Familiarize yourself with the van’s driving dynamics, especially if you’re not used to driving larger vehicles. Practice maneuvering and parking the van in an empty parking lot before hitting the road.

4. Follow the rental company’s guidelines for cleaning and returning the van to avoid any additional fees. Treat the van with care and respect to ensure a smooth rental experience.
